2003 Mini One R50 1.6 petrol with the "Midlands" 5 speed box.
Hi,
Going to change the transmission oil soon and just wanted to check if I should or need to replace the crush washers on the fill and drain plugs or can I reuse them?
Unable to find anyone that sells them in the UK any ideas?
I guess if I knew the Internal & Outer Diameter & Thickness I could order of fleabay.
The car has done 140k but as the new owner I cannot ascertain if the box has ever been changed. From what I've read it seems unlikely that it would still be the original box????? If it is and nobody has ever replaced the transmission oil then I guess it's going to be very thin and I should expect lots of metal on the magnetic plug.
As I intend to do this myself is it going to any easier if I remove the NS front wheel or am I just best getting enough height to get to the plugs from underneath?

The washers should be replaced and not reused otherwise you risked getting a leak.
Get it from the dealer I would think?
Parts list says it an M14 x 1.5 threaded plug part number 7513050 and is listed with its washer as a unit, washer not listed as separate item, but I suppose it must be in reality.
Plenty of sump crush washer suppliers on line if you Google, seem expensive for what they are though.
